OverviewNCBI Gene

The WNT gene family consists of structurally related genes which encode secreted signaling proteins. These proteins have been implicated in oncogenesis and in several developmental processes, including regulation of cell fate and patterning during embryogenesis. This gene is a member of the WNT gene family. It is overexpressed in cervical cancer cell line and strongly coexpressed with another family member, WNT10A, in colorectal cancer cell line. The gene overexpression may play key roles in carcinogenesis. This gene and the WNT10A gene are clustered in the chromosome 2q35 region. The protein encoded by this gene is 97% identical to the mouse Wnt6 protein at the amino acid level. [provided by RefSeq, Jul 2008]

Seroatlas reads WNT6 as an antibody target. Whether an autoantibody or antibody against WNT6 could matter depends on whether native WNT6 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.

WNT6 is annotated as secreted, so native WNT6 circulates and is directly accessible to antibodies. Secreted and cell-surface proteins are the autoantibody targets most likely to act like drugs, blocking or depleting the native protein.
